The verdict

JDR Enterprises runs at 264% of its industry's injury rate - far more dangerous than the typical Awnings, rigid plastics or fiberglass, manufacturing workplace, earning a grade F.

Year-by-Year Safety Data

Year TCR DART Injuries Illnesses Fatalities
2024 11.8 7.9 6 0 0
2023 3.5 3.5 1 1 0
2022 8.2 4.1 6 0 0
2021 11.4 6.3 9 0 0
